Insider Tips for Mastering Petite and Plus Size Styling

Navigating the world of petite and plus size fashion doesn’t have to be a constant challenge. A few savvy tips can make all the difference in achieving that perfectly polished look:

  • Become Best Friends with a Tailor: This isn’t just a tip for petite individuals; it’s essential for everyone seeking a truly custom fit. A skilled tailor can transform a ten-dollar dress into a piece that looks like a hundred, simply by ensuring it fits your unique body perfectly. For petite and plus size figures, tailoring can customize everything from sleeve length to shoulder width, making mass-produced garments feel bespoke.
  • Rock Those Patterns and Prints (Wisely!): You might have heard the old adage that petite individuals shouldn’t wear bold prints. Dispel that myth! It’s not about avoiding patterns but understanding scale and placement. When choosing prints, consider where you want to draw the eye to or away from. A well-placed, appropriately scaled pattern can enhance your silhouette and add incredible visual interest without overwhelming your frame.
  • Avoid Just Shortening Pants: This is a crucial distinction. Simply chopping length off a pair of standard-sized pants almost always alters the entire line of the leg. The “break” in the knee, the taper of the leg, and the overall silhouette are designed for a taller frame. If you do get pants tailored, ensure your tailor accounts for the original shape and proportions of the entire garment, not just the hem, to maintain a flattering fit for your petite and plus size figure.
  • Dresses and Jackets Demand Attention: These categories can be particularly tricky for the petite and plus size shopper if a specific style or proportion is desired. Pay close attention to where the waist is emphasized on a dress – an ideal waistline hits at your natural waist or slightly higher to elongate your frame. For jackets, look at shoulder fit and sleeve length. If you are lucky enough to have an amazing tailor, they will be your greatest asset here, ensuring these pieces drape beautifully and enhance your proportions.
